+/* Subroutine of pex_unix_exec_child. Move OLD_FD to a new file descriptor
+ to be stored in *PNEW_FD, save the flags in *PFLAGS, and arrange for the
+ saved copy to be close-on-exec. Move CHILD_FD into OLD_FD. If CHILD_FD
+ is -1, OLD_FD is to be closed. Return -1 on error. */
+
+static int
+save_and_install_fd(int *pnew_fd, int *pflags, int old_fd, int child_fd)
+{
+ int new_fd, flags;
+
+ flags = fcntl (old_fd, F_GETFD);
+
+ /* If we could not retrieve the flags, then OLD_FD was not open. */
+ if (flags < 0)
+ {
+ new_fd = -1, flags = 0;
+ if (child_fd >= 0 && dup2 (child_fd, old_fd) < 0)
+ return -1;
+ }
+ /* If we wish to close OLD_FD, just mark it CLOEXEC. */
+ else if (child_fd == -1)
+ {
+ new_fd = old_fd;
+ if ((flags & FD_CLOEXEC) == 0 && fcntl (old_fd, F_SETFD, FD_CLOEXEC) < 0)
+ return -1;
+ }
+ /* Otherwise we need to save a copy of OLD_FD before installing CHILD_FD. */
+ else
+ {
+#ifdef F_DUPFD_CLOEXEC
+ new_fd = fcntl (old_fd, F_DUPFD_CLOEXEC, 3);
+ if (new_fd < 0)
+ return -1;
+#else
+ /* Prefer F_DUPFD over dup in order to avoid getting a new fd
+ in the range 0-2, right where a new stderr fd might get put. */
+ new_fd = fcntl (old_fd, F_DUPFD, 3);
+ if (new_fd < 0)
+ return -1;
+ if (fcntl (new_fd, F_SETFD, FD_CLOEXEC) < 0)
+ return -1;
+#endif
+ if (dup2 (child_fd, old_fd) < 0)
+ return -1;
+ }
+
+ *pflags = flags;
+ if (pnew_fd)
+ *pnew_fd = new_fd;
+ else if (new_fd != old_fd)
+ abort ();
+
+ return 0;
+}

+/* Subroutine of pex_unix_exec_child. Move SAVE_FD back to OLD_FD
+ restoring FLAGS. If SAVE_FD < 0, OLD_FD is to be closed. */
+
+static int
+restore_fd(int old_fd, int save_fd, int flags)
+{
+ /* For SAVE_FD < 0, all we have to do is restore the
+ "closed-ness" of the original. */
+ if (save_fd < 0)
+ return close (old_fd);
+
+ /* For SAVE_FD == OLD_FD, all we have to do is restore the
+ original setting of the CLOEXEC flag. */
+ if (save_fd == old_fd)
+ {
+ if (flags & FD_CLOEXEC)
+ return 0;
+ return fcntl (old_fd, F_SETFD, flags);
+ }
+
+ /* Otherwise we have to move the descriptor back, restore the flags,
+ and close the saved copy. */
+#ifdef HAVE_DUP3
+ if (flags == FD_CLOEXEC)
+ {
+ if (dup3 (save_fd, old_fd, O_CLOEXEC) < 0)
+ return -1;
+ }
+ else
+#endif
+ {
+ if (dup2 (save_fd, old_fd) < 0)
+ return -1;
+ if (flags != 0 && fcntl (old_fd, F_SETFD, flags) < 0)
+ return -1;
+ }
+ return close (save_fd);
+}
